dtd
D-tyrosyl-tRNA(Tyr) deacylase Dtd; An aminoacyl-tRNA editing enzyme that deacylates mischarged D-aminoacyl-tRNAs. Also deacylates mischarged glycyl-tRNA(Ala), protecting cells against glycine mischarging by AlaRS. Acts via tRNA- based rather than protein-based catalysis; rejects L-amino acids rather than detecting D-amino acids in the active site. By recycling D- aminoacyl-tRNA to D-amino acids and free tRNA molecules, this enzyme counteracts the toxicity associated with the formation of D-aminoacyl- tRNA entities in vivo and helps enforce protein L-homochirality. Belongs to the DTD family.

oleC
Polyolefin biosynthetic pathway AMP transfer protein OleC; Involved in olefin biosynthesis. Catalyzes the conversion of 2-alkyl-3-hydroxyalkanoic acids to beta-lactones in the presence of ATP (By similarity). The S.oneidensis oleABCD genes produce 3,6,9,12,15,19,22,25,28-hentriacontanonaene, which may aid the cells in adapting to a sudden drop in temperature.
